What's new in WSS 3.0 and SharePoint Server 2007
Read OriginalThis article provides notes from a SharePoint 2007 seminar, detailing the differences between WSS 3.0 (free) and SharePoint Server 2007 (licensed). Key updates include full browser compatibility (IE and Firefox), replacement of 'Areas' with 'Sites', renaming of 'Virtual Server' to 'Web Site', and integration of CMS Server into SharePoint 2007. It also covers new features in WSS 3.0 such as built-in breadcrumbs, site navigation, security improvements (access-based visibility), file-based permissions, and document collaboration with major/minor versioning. The article is a technical overview aimed at IT professionals and SharePoint users.
